In this modern age, there are numerous applications and software that have been developed by web and mobile developers for making certain tasks much easier. In most businesses and professions, it entails coming up with new ideas through the process of mind mapping. When creating a mind map, it often entails creating a visual representation of a main idea accompanied by connecting branches, which relay associated or relevant sub topics.

Even though one can do this by simply writing everything down on paper, there are alternative means like doing so digitally. This is more convenient nowadays, especially when it comes to projects that require collaboration from other colleagues or feedback from clients. Following this trail of thought, this article will be emphasizing on the best modern programs for free concept map maker tasks.

Coggle is the first option on this list and is available to utilize on Chrome or on all sorts of web browsers. It has numerous features that users find useful, such as being able to allocate certain colors with different branches or nodes. The map may also be accessed by other people, allowing users to place comments and add accompanying images to each node. Furthermore, one is also able to send messages, making it an excellent collaborative tool for startups and other small companies.

Mind Mapple is available in various platforms, including those who wish to access it through a web browser instead of downloads, which takes up a lot of space. It has many features that users enjoy, like being able to integrate cloud sharing properties and integrating Google drive. Due to this, sharing files is easier than ever and also allows you to bookmark nodes for future reference and labeling each one.

Nova Mind is the most flexible out of all the options on this list because it may be accessed on all formats and platforms. What sets it apart is a tutorial mode feature, which teaches new users how to fully utilize all its attributes upon using. Although it limits itself to only twenty five mind maps, which means on must complete a project first or they can no longer create new ones once the limit has been reached.

Text2Mindmap is like what the label suggests. It allows one to take note of random ideas or brainstorming thoughts throughout the day wherein they may then convert it into a text based file. Even though the controls and attributes are very basic and simplistic in its formatting, many still prefer using it because of its flexibility and accessibility. Moreover, it also takes up smaller storage space compared to its other competitors.

Another addition to this list is Blumind, which is most notable for its three main attributes. This includes user functionality, portability, and the fact that it is free of charge. Even though it only has basic features, users appreciate its functionality and the fact that they can download it for free from their website. What sets it apart is a timer tool, which limits the amount of time spent on a specific mind map.

Sketchboard allows you to post images and also make use of its premade icons and illustrations. More than three users can go online at the same time to collaborate in real time as well. Even though its trial version is only up to 5 years, you already have access to all it has to offer. Renewing the existing account after 5 years will be up to you after it expires.

Lastly, is Visual Understanding Environment, which was created by a group of developers from Tufts University. The program was only released this year and since then has gone through recent updates to fine tune it. VUE also allows one to save the files in various formats, including PDFs, HTMLs, RDFs, or safe storing it on the VUE website for lesser space consumption.
